Cold Kaons from Hot Fireballs
Abstract
The E814-collaboration has found a component of very low $m_t$ $K^+$ mesons with a slope parameter of $T \sim 15 \, \rm MeV$. We will present a scenario which explains the observed slope parameter and which allows us to predict the expected slope parameter for kaons produced in heavier systems such as Au+Au. Implications for the restoration of chiral symmetry in relativistic heavy ion collisions are discussed.(figures are being sent on request)
